Job description: We are seeking a strategic, motivated, and self-directed Marketing Director to lead and execute comprehensive marketing initiatives at Full Smile Management. This role is responsible for driving brand visibility, patient acquisition, and community engagement across multiple markets while ensuring alignment with organizational goals. The ideal candidate is a proactive self-starter with strong leadership skills, a data-driven mindset, and hands-on experience managing marketing budgets, campaigns, and community-focused initiatives. The Marketing Director is responsible for, but not limited to, the following duties: • Develop, implement, and oversee a comprehensive marketing strategy supporting our clinics throughout Texas and New Mexico. • Lead planning, execution, and optimization of marketing campaigns across digital, print, and in-person channels. •Oversee community outreach and event strategy, including health fairs, school visits, patient appreciation events, ribbon cuttings, seasonal celebrations, and internal company events. • Identify and prioritize event and outreach opportunities aligned with brand objectives, growth initiatives, and patient acquisition goals. • Ensure a consistent, professional brand presence across all public-facing materials, events, and communications. •Own the marketing budget, including spend tracking, reconciliation, forecasting, and cost optimization. •Collaborate with finance and executive leadership on budget development and ongoing financial oversight. •Analyze marketing, campaign, and event performance to evaluate ROI, engagement, and patient growth. •Develop and maintain marketing dashboards, KPIs, and reporting tools to support data-driven decision-making. •Oversee content strategy for digital platforms, including social media, email marketing, and website initiatives. •Provide leadership, direction, and mentorship to marketing staff, vendors, and external partners. •Manage vendor relationships, contracts, timelines, and deliverables. •Collaborate cross-functionally to align marketing initiatives with operational and growth priorities. •Stay current on industry trends, tools, and best practices to continuously enhance marketing effectiveness. Marketing Director Requirements •Master’s degree in Marketing, Communications, Public Relations, Business, or a related field (preferred). Bachelor’s degree in Marketing or a related field will be considered in lieu of a master’s degree. •Minimum of 5 years of progressive marketing experience, including strategic planning and execution. •Demonstrated experience managing, reconciling, and forecasting marketing budgets. •Strong analytical skills with the ability to interpret data, measure ROI, and translate insights into actionable strategies. •Highly motivated self-starter with the ability to work independently and manage competing priorities. •Excellent organizational, leadership, and communication skills. •Experience with digital marketing platforms, CRM systems, email marketing tools, and analytics. •Proficiency in Microsoft Office and Canva; familiarity with marketing dashboards and performance reporting tools. •Ability to travel regularly throughout Texas to support events, practices, and outreach initiatives. •Willingness to work occasional evenings and weekends to support key events and campaigns. •Ability to lift and transport event materials (up to 25 lbs), as needed. •Warm, confident, and professional communicator both in person and online.
